This quiet residential area in Kent County offers spacious living with larger lot sizes that provide more room to spread out compared to typical urban neighborhoods. The location strikes a practical balance with solid walkability for daily errands and excellent transit access, while maintaining a peaceful suburban feel just minutes from Pinery Park and two other parks within walking distance.

Residents enjoy convenient access to everyday necessities, with grocery stores and restaurants easily reachable, though coffee lovers will need to venture a bit further for their favorite brew. The proximity to Battjes Lake and multiple boat launches within a short drive appeals to water enthusiasts, while the mix of owner-occupied homes creates a stable community atmosphere. Students attend Wyoming Public Schools, which includes some highly-rated options in the district. This area works well for families seeking space and tranquility while staying connected to Grand Rapids' amenities, and outdoor enthusiasts who appreciate nearby water recreation opportunities.
